THE MEANING OF MAGGIE BY: MEGAN JEAN SOVERN

Product Details"This book is coming out in May 2014"

REVIEW: ****
I usually don't read sad novels, but this one was awesome, amazing, and wonderful! If I had to give an award to a sad and funny story, it would be this one. The author has done a great job of mixing such opposite emotions in a story.  What I love about the main character Maggie is that she is someone all kids can relate to.  She is a typical 11/12 year old who is smart and nerdy.

SUMMARY: 

Eleven year old Maggie want to make a difference. She desperately wants to help her dad fix his problem. His big problem is that, in Maggie's words, "her dads legs fall asleep". permanently. his problem is a serious medical disease that Maggie doesn't understand.  This book is a short read about the meaning of her life. And while everything in Maggie's world is falling apart, she finds a way to pull herself together by pulling up her "boot straps" (the family motto) no matter what is going on.  Throughout the book the reader will find out who Maggie really is.
